Step 1: Preheat oven to 450 degrees F.
Step 2: Line a baking sheet or pizza pan with parchment paper or foil, sprayed with non-stick vegetable cooking spray.
Step 3: In a medium bowl combine the ground chicken with 1/4 cup Parmesan, 1/4 cup Mozzarella, 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on black pepper, 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der and 1/2 teaspoon oregano.
Step 4: Mound the chicken mixture onto the parchment, and pat into flat rectangle or disc.
Step 5: Cover with plastic wrap, and evenly press or roll the chicken into a 7x10" rectangle or round. I use a rolling pin!
Step 6: Remove the plastic wrap, and roast until golden, 12-15 minutes, draining any liquid that may be in the pan at 12 minutes, then putting it back in if it's not brown enough.
Step 7: Smear crust with sauce, scatter with 1/4 cup Parmesan, 3/4 cup Mozzarella, layer with toppings, and season with a sprinkle of crushed red pepper flakes and 1/4 teaspoon oregano.
Step 8: Pop back into hot oven, and cook until melted and bubbly, 6-10 minutes.
Step 9: Remove from oven, and sprinkle with chopped basil.
